What are some subtle signs that someone is mentally unstable? by [deleted] in AskReddit

[–]Forward-Revolution34 0 points1 point  (0 children)

based on my observation coz my friend having this feeling recently. it can include drastic mood swings, withdrawing from social activities, or changes in sleep patterns. It's also common for someone to express feelings of hopelessness or display sudden changes in their energy levels.
